Linear Technology Corporation introduces the LT6001 and LT6002

作者:eaw  时间:2006-03-02 14:30  来源:本站原创

Linear Technology Corporation introduces the LT6001 and LT6002, the industry's first 1..8V dual and quad operational amplifiers available in a tiny DFN package. These micropower devices draw only 13uA per amplifier and have excellent performance characteristics. Input offset voltage is 500uV max at 25°C with a maximum drift of 5uV/°C over temperature. Inputs and outputs feature rail-to rail-operation.

This combination of low supply voltage, low current consumption and excellent DC specifications in a tiny DFN package make these parts ideal for handheld and battery-powered applications.

For even greater power savings, the dual LT6001 in 3mm x 3mm package also includes a shutdown pin, allowing current consumption to drop to 1.5uA max when not in use. The LT6001 and LT6002 are available now with prices starting from $1.25 and $2.00 each in 1,000-piece quantities.

Summary of Features: LT6001 & LT6002
Ideal for Battery-Powered Applications
- Low Voltage: 1.8V Operation
- Low Current: 16uA/Amplifier Max
- Small Packages: DFN, MSOP, SSOP
- Shutdown to 1.5uA Max (LT6001DD)
Low Offset Voltage: 500uV Max
Rail-to-Rail Input and Output
Fully Specified on 1.8V and 5V Supplies
Operating Temperature Range: -40°C to 85°C

Available in 10-Lead & 16-Lead DFN, 8-Lead MSOP & 16-Lead SSOP Packages
